  4. To polish up my headlights (came up a treat;)) and minor body work bits. Because is has variable speeds there is a reduced riskof burning. My mate who is a pro detailer said it was pretty good. Aparently the trick to avoid burning the paint is to remove the side-handle and hold the back of the spinner and apply the pressure from there. I'm based near Enfield but work in Central London.
